After another long day, the team arrived safely at Shira Camp (Elevation: 3050m/9950ft to 3850m/12,600ft which sits on the Eastern edge of the Shira Plateau.) The hike to Shira Camp is one of the most scenic on the mountain. The team can see Kibo, Mt. Meru in the distance.


The hike begins in the tropical rainforest and blends quite quickly into a shrubland setting. Some people refer to this zone on Kilimanjaro as moorland or low-alpine landscape. Along the way they'll see interesting fauna and flora. Perhaps they will glimpse a sight of the White Naped Raven as they climb.
